Here’s Washington Wizards small forward Corey Kispert on how the team has handled losing this season compared to previous years (2-15 record/13-game losing streak).
(via Washington Wizards):
“There’s a lot less finger pointing. There’s a lot less blame. There’s a lot less negativity. And that’s the start. We continue to encourage each other. We continue to build each other up both across the entire locker room, but also privately in one-on-one conversations. That’s the key. Things are bad. We’re in a big skid and we’re struggling, but things aren’t toxic. There’s a big difference between the two.”
